
/* ===================== 1. zobrazeni start   - desktop  =====================  */	
	
	@media only screen and (min-width : 800px)
{	

/* ==================== Základní parametry start ====================== */

body, html
{
	margin:0;
	padding:0;
	font-size: 100%;
	color: Black;
	background-color : White;
	font-family : Arial, Helvetica, sans-serif;
	/* font-family : Georgia, sans-serif;  */
}


#wrapper 
    {
	width:100%;
	max-width:960px;
	margin:0 auto;     /* zarovnání na střed stránky */
}

/* ==================== Základní parametry end  ====================== */

/* ====================  Header 1 start  ====================== */		
	
.header_1_wrap{
	max-width:1000px;
	margin:0 auto;
	background-color : #CFCFCF;
	margin-top : 10px;
}
		
	.header_1_sloupec_levy{
	width: 35%;
	float: left;
	sbackground-color : Fuchsia;
}
	
	
.header_1_sloupec_levy p
	{
	text-align : left;
	sfont-size : 2.6875em;
	/* 43px/16=2.6875% */
	color:#3d3d3d;
	padding-left : 0px;
}	

.header_1_sloupec_levy a
	{
	font-size : 30px;
	text-decoration : none;
	color : Black;
	font-weight : bold;
	font-family : "Arial Black";
}	

/* ======================================== */				

.header_1_sloupec_stredovy
	{
	width: 30%;
	float: left;
	sbackground-color : green;
	text-align : center;
}	

      .header_1_sloupec_stredovy p
	{
	text-align : center;
	/* line-height : 25px;   */
	font-size : 21px;
	color:black;
}	

.hledej_input
{
	width : 55%;
	font-size : 18px;
	height : 20px;
	padding-top : 1px;
	padding-bottom : 2px;
}	

.hledej_tlacitko
{
	background-color : #b9b9b9;
	border : 1px solid black;
	padding-top : 5px;
	padding-bottom : 2px;
	padding-left : 10px;
	padding-right : 10px;
	font-weight : bolder;
}	



/* ======================================== */			


.header_1_sloupec_pravy
	{
	width: 35%;
	float: right;
	sbackground-color : Blue;
}	

      .header_1_sloupec_pravy p
	{
	text-align : right;
	/* line-height : 25px;
	*/
	font-size : 18px;
	color:black;
	line-height : 8px;
}	

/* ======================================== */		

/* ====================  Header 1 end  ====================== */	

/* ====================  Header 2 start  ====================== */		

.header_2 {
	max-width:1000px;
	margin:0 auto;
	background-color : #b9b9b9;
	height : 8px;
}

/* ====================  Header 2 end  ====================== */	

/* ====================  Main start  ====================== */		

.main_wrap {
	max-width:1000px;
	margin:0 auto;
	height : 500px;
}

	.sidebar {
	width: 25%;
	float: left;
	padding-top : 6%;
}

	.main {
	width: 73%;
	float: left;
	padding-left : 4%;
	padding-right : 0%;
	padding-top : 6%;
	padding-bottom : 1%;
	text-align : center;
	font-size: 18px;
	sline-height : 26px;
	color : #373737;
	
	
		/*   kvuli vnitrnim paddingum aby nemely vliv na celou velikost     */ 
	  box-sizing:border-box;
    -moz-box-sizing:border-box; /* Firefox */
    -webkit-box-sizing:border-box; /* Safari */
	
}

.main p
{
text-align : left;
}

.main h1
{
font-size:25px;
}



/* ====================  Main end  ====================== */	

/* ====================  Footer 1 start  ====================== */		

.footer_1 {
	max-width:1000px;
	margin:0 auto;
	background-color : #b9b9b9;
	height : 8px;
}

/* ====================  Footer 1 end  ====================== */	

/* ====================  Footer 1 start  ====================== */		

.footer_2 {
	max-width:1000px;
	margin:0 auto;
	height : 50px;
	text-align : center;
	color : Gray;
}

.footer_2  a
{
	color : Gray;
	font-size : 15px;
	text-decoration : none;
}

/* ====================  Footer 1 end  ====================== */	

/* ====================  Galerie vypis start  ====================== */		

		  .galerie_vypis
	{
		width: 100%;
		margin:0 auto;
		text-align:center;
		margin-top:0px;
		margin-bottom:0px;
	}
	
		.galerie_vypis_sloupec_50{
	width: 40%;
	float: left;
	padding-left : 5%;
	padding-right : 5%;
	padding-top : 3%;
	padding-bottom : 3%;
}

.galerie_vypis_sloupec_50 p{
	text-align : center;
}


/* ====================  Galerie vypis end  ====================== */		

/* ====================  stranky vypis start  ====================== */		

.stranky_vypis_wrap 
{
	width : 100%;
}

.stranky_vypis_sloupec_levy
{
	float : left;
	width : 48%;
	padding-top : 25px;
}

.stranky_vypis_sloupec_pravy
{
	float : right;
	width : 48%;
}

.stranky_vypis_sloupec_pravy a
{
	font-size : 22px;
	color : Black;
}


/* ====================  stranky vypis end  ====================== */		

/* ====================  detail fotky start  ====================== */		


.detail_fotky_wrap
    {
	width:100%;
	max-width:960px;
	margin:0 auto;
	text-align : center;
}

.detail_fotky_wrap hr
    {
	width:100%;
	color : Black;
	background-color : Black;
	height : 1px;
	border : 0px;
}

/* ======================================== */		

.detail_fotky_header_1
{
	padding-top : 10px;
	padding-bottom : 5px;
}

.detail_fotky_header_1 p
{
	font-size : 26px;
}

.detail_fotky_header_1 a
{
	color : Black;
}

/* ======================================== */		

.buttony_vpred_zpet {
	-webkit-border-radius: 0;
	-moz-border-radius: 0;
	border-radius: 0px;
	font-family: Arial;
	color: black;
	font-size: 1.7vw;
	background: Silver;
	padding: 0.6vw 0.6vw 0.6vw 0.6vw;
	text-decoration: none;
	background-color : #ffbe0e;
	font-weight : bold;
	margin-left : 0.7vw;
	margin-right : 0.7vw;
}

/* ======================================== */		

.detail_fotky_header_2
{
	padding-top : 10px;
	padding-bottom : 5px;
}

/* ======================================== */		

.detail_fotky_header_3
{
	padding-top : 10px;
	padding-bottom : 15px;
}

/* ======================================== */		

.detail_fotky_main_foto
{
	padding-top : 10px;
	padding-bottom : 15px;
}

/* ======================================== */		

.detail_fotky_popis
{
	padding-top : 10px;
	padding-bottom : 15px;
}

/* ====================  detail fotky end  ====================== */		

/* ==================== Header 6 start  ====================== */		

 .home_sloupce
	{
	margin:0 auto;
	max-width:959px;
	min-height: 50px;
	/*+ background-color:fuchsia;    */
}
	
		.home_sloupec{
	width: 24.3333333333%;
	smin-height: 500px;
	background-color : #DADADA;
	float: left;
	margin-left: 2%;
	margin-right: 2%;
	text-align : center;
	margin-top:2.5%;
	margin-bottom:2.5%;
	padding-left : 2.5%;
	padding-right : 2.5%;
}
	
.home_sloupec p{

	text-align : center;
	margin-top : 0px;
	padding-top : 0px;
	margin-bottom : 0px;
	padding-bottom: 0px;
	
	
}	

.home_sloupec img{
	text-align : center;
	border : 0px solid #acacac;
}	

.home_sloupec a{
	scolor : White;
	sfont-size : 20px;
}	

p.home_sloupec_nadpis{
	color : black;
	font-size : 18px;
	padding-top : 10px;
	padding-bottom : 10px;
}	

p.home_sloupec_popis{
	color : black;
	font-size : 16px;
	padding-top : 12px;
	padding-bottom : 10px;
	
}	

p.home_sloupec_cena{
	color : Red;
	font-size : 20px;
	padding-top : 5px;
	padding-bottom : 15px;
}	

/* ==================== Header 6 end  ====================== */		



.detail_related_zbozi_sloupce_wrap {
	width : 90%;
	background-color : Aqua;
	margin-left : 10%;
}

.detail_related_zbozi_sloupec_levy{
	sbackground-color : Lime;
	width : 36%;
	min-height:250px;
	_height:250px;
	float : left;
	padding-left : 0%;
	padding-right : 2%;
	padding-top : 8%;
}


.detail_related_zbozi_sloupec_pravy {
	sbackground-color : #FCF8E7;
	width : 50%;
	float : left;
	text-align : center;
	padding-left : 0%;
	padding-right : 0%;
	padding-top : 4%;
	
}

.detail_related_zbozi_sloupec_pravy  p
{
	text-align : left;
	color : #5A5A5A;
	font-size : 16px;
	font-weight : Normal;
	line-height : 150%;
	padding-left : 6%;
	padding-right : 6%;
}

.detail_related_zbozi_ hr
{
	/*
	width : 90%;
	color : #2fa2fb;
	background-color : #2fa2fb;
	border : 0px solid Green;
	*/
	
	stext-align : center;
	width : 80%;
	margin:0 auto;
	color : #2fa2fb;
	background-color : #2fa2fb;
	height : 1px;
	border:0px;
	
}

/* ====================  detail zbozi eshop start   ====================== */	


.detail{
	max-width:808px;
	width:100%;
	margin:0 auto;
	min-height : 500px;
	background-color : White;
	text-align : center;
	border: 1px solid Silver;
	margin-top : 0px;
}

.detail p {
	padding-left : 6%;
	padding-right : 6%;
}

.detail h1{
	padding-top : 4%;
	padding-bottom : 6%;
	font-size: 1.4em;
	color : gray;
}

.detail h2{
	padding-top : 10px;
	padding-bottom : 10px;
	font-size: 1.1em;
	color : #4169E1;
}


.detail_sloupce_wrap{
	width : 100%;
	sbackground-color : Aqua; 
}

.detail_sloupec_levy{
	sbackground-color : Lime;
	width : 46%;
	min-height:340px;
	_height:340px;
	float : left;
	padding-left : 2%;
	padding-right : 2%;
}


.detail_sloupec_pravy {
	sbackground-color : #FCF8E7;
	width : 46%;
	float : left;
	text-align : center;
	min-height : 312px;
	_height:312px;
	padding-left : 2%;
	padding-right : 2%;
	
}

.detail_sloupec_pravy  p
{
	text-align : justify;
	color : #5A5A5A;
	font-size : 16px;
	font-weight : Normal;
	line-height : 150%;
	padding-left : 6%;
	padding-right : 6%;
}

.detail hr
{
	/*width : 90%;
	color : #2fa2fb;
	background-color : #2fa2fb;
	border : 0px solid Green;
	*/
	stext-align : center;
	width : 80%;
	margin:0 auto;
	color : Gray;
	background-color : Gray;
	height : 1px;
	border:0px;
}


/* ====================  vyber barva velikost start   ====================== */	

.vyber_barva_velikost_wrap{
	width : 100%;
	sbackground-color : Aqua; 
	padding-top : 2vw;
	padding-bottom : 4vw;
}

.vyber_barva_velikost_sloupec_levy {
	sbackground-color : Lime;
	width : 46%;
	smin-height:70px;
	s_height:70px;
	float : left;
	padding-left : 2%;
	padding-right : 2%;
}


.vyber_barva_velikost_sloupec_pravy{
	sbackground-color : #FCF8E7;
	width : 46%;
	float : left;
	text-align : center;
	smin-height : 312px;
	s_height:312px;
	padding-left : 2%;
	padding-right : 2%;
	
}

/* ====================  vyber barva velikost start   ====================== */	

/* ====================  Koupit start   ====================== */	

.koupit{
	width : 100%;
	sbackground-color : Aqua;
	padding-top : 1vw;
	padding-bottom : 3vw;
}

/* ====================  Koupit end   ====================== */	



/* ==================== detail zbozi eshop end   ====================== */

/* =================================== */		

		  .social_buttons_set
	{
		width: 20%;
		height:30px;
		sbackground-color: red;
		max-width:959px;
		margin:0 auto;
		text-align:center;
		margin-top:3%;
		margin-bottom:0px;
	}
	
		.social_buttons_sloupec
		{

	width: 28.3333333333%;
	sbackground-color: fuchsia;
	float: left;
	margin-left: 2.5%;
	margin-right: 2.5%;
	text-align : center;
	margin-top:2.5%;
	margin-bottom:10%;
	
}

/* =================================== */		

/* ==================== Pokladna cast 1 start ====================== */

#pokladna_cast_1{

}

#pokladna_cast_1  hr
 {
	height : 1px;
	background-color : Gray;
	color : Gray;
	border : 0px;
}

#pokladna_cast_1  h2
 {
	color : Gray;
	text-align : center;
}

.tlacitko_prepocitat  {
	background-color : #7aa60f;
	font-family : Arial;
	font-size: 11px;
	color: White;
	font-weight : bold;
	border : 1px solid black;
	padding-top : 3px;
	padding-bottom : 3px;
	padding-left : 7px;
	padding-right : 7px;
}


.pokladna_table_cast_1

{
	background-color : #EDFBCE;
	padding-left : 10px;
	padding-right : 10px;
	padding-top : 10px;
	padding-bottom : 10px;
}


.pokladna_polozka_cast_1_1

{
	font-size: 12px;
	font-weight : bold;
	width : 60%;
	  /* background-color : Aqua;  */ 
}

.pokladna_polozka_cast_1_2

{
	font-size: 12px;
	font-weight : bold;
	width : 10%;
	  /* background-color : Fuchsia;  */ 
}

.pokladna_polozka_cast_1_3

{
	font-size: 12px;
	font-weight : bold;
	width : 5%;
	padding-left : 5px;
	  /* background-color : Aqua;  */ 
}

.pokladna_polozka_cast_1_4

{
	font-size: 12px;
	font-weight : bold;
	width : 10%;
	padding-left : 10px;
	/*  background-color : Fuchsia;  */
}

.pokladna_polozka_cast_1_5

{
  padding-left : 8px;
  /* background-color : Aqua;  */ 
}

.pokladna_soucet_cast_1_1

{
	font-size: 12px;
	font-weight : bold;
	width : 60%;
	color : Red;
	padding-top : 30px;
}

.pokladna_soucet_cast_1_2

{
	font-size: 12px;
	font-weight : bold;
	color : Red;
	padding-top : 30px;
	padding-left : 10px;
	width : 10%;
}


.pokladna_polozka_cast_1_input {
	font-size:11px;
	color: Black;
	background-color : White;
	font-weight : normal;
	width : 25px;
	border : 1px solid #8b8b8b;
	vertical-align : top;
	margin-top : 1px;
	margin-left : 5px;
}

.pokladna_kontaktni_udaje_input {
	font-size:1em;
	color: Black;
	background-color : White;
	font-weight : normal;
	width : 77%;
	border : 1px solid #8b8b8b;
}

td.popispolozka {
	font-size:1em;
	height : 32px;
}


/* ==================== Pokladna cast 1 end ====================== */	
	
/* ==================== Pokladna cast 2 rekapitulace start ====================== */	

p.rekapitulace_napis {
	font-size:1.4vw;
	color : Green;
	font-weight : bold;
}

/* ==================== Pokladna cast 2 rekapitulace end ====================== */		

.btn {
	-webkit-border-radius: 0;
	-moz-border-radius: 0;
	border-radius: 0px;
	font-family: Arial;
	color: black;
	font-size: 12px;
	background: #4169E1;
	padding: 8px 18px 8px 18px;
	text-decoration: none;
	margin-left:10px;
	font-weight : bold;
}

.btn:hover {
  background:#ffca00;
  text-decoration: none;
}	

/* ==================== Tlacitka  start ====================== */

.tlacitko_standart {
	background-color : #339900;
	/* background-color : #fcd228;
	*/
	font-family : Arial;
	font-size:11pt;
	color: White;
	font-weight : bolder;
	border : 1px solid black;
	padding-top : 5px;
	padding-bottom : 5px;
	padding-left : 10px;
	padding-right : 10px;
}

.tlacitko_koupit {
	background-color : #339900;
	/* background-color : #fcd228;
	*/
	font-family : Arial;
	font-size:11pt;
	color: White;
	font-weight : bolder;
	border : 1px solid black;
	padding-top : 5px;
	padding-bottom : 5px;
	padding-left : 10px;
	padding-right : 10px;
}


/* ==================== Tlacitka  end ====================== */



}

